How Zapier works
Zapier makes it easy to integrate Calendar with Microsoft Teams - no code necessary. See how you can get setup in minutes.
Choose a trigger
A trigger is the event that starts your Zap—like a "New Meeting Scheduled" from Calendar.
Add your action
An action happens after the trigger—such as "Create Channel" in Microsoft Teams.

Frequently Asked Questions about Calendar + Microsoft Teams integrations
New to automation with Zapier? You're not alone. Here are some answers to common questions about how Zapier works with Calendar and Microsoft Teams
Can I automate event creations in Microsoft Teams when a new event is added to my Calendar?
Yes, you can automate event creations in Microsoft Teams when a new event is added to your Calendar. By setting up a trigger for new events in your Calendar, we can automatically create a corresponding meeting or reminder in Microsoft Teams.
How do I sync Calendar events with Microsoft Teams channels?
Syncing Calendar events with specific Microsoft Teams channels is possible by using triggers that detect updates or additions to your Calendar. Our integration allows these Calendar changes to be posted directly into a designated Teams channel as a message.
Is it possible to send notifications to Microsoft Teams for upcoming Calendar events?
Yes, we provide the ability to send customizable notifications to Microsoft Teams for upcoming events on your Calendar. You just need to set up the appropriate trigger for the upcoming event notification you require.
Can recurring Calendar events be reflected on Microsoft Teams automatically?
Absolutely, recurring events from your Calendar can be automatically reflected on Microsoft Teams. By establishing the right trigger actions, each recurrence will synchronize with your Team's schedule or reminders.
What actions can I perform in Microsoft Teams based on my Calendar's schedule?
You can perform several actions within Microsoft Teams based on your Calendar's schedule. For example, you might configure messages or channel posts whenever an event starts or changes are made.
How do I handle time zone differences between my Calendar and Microsoft Teams?
Our integration tools allow you to manage time zone settings accordingly. When setting triggers and actions, ensure that both platforms are aligned by specifying the correct time zones during setup.
Can I integrate tasks from my Calendar into Microsoft Teams tasks?
Yes, integrating tasks from your Calendar into Tasks by Planner and To Do within Microsoft Teams is feasible. This involves setting up a trigger-action mechanism where new tasks from your calendar appear as actionable items in your selected team's task list.
